This is the exact recipe from kuali.com :


Ingredients


1.5kg crabs, preferably mud crabs
200g margarine
1 can evaporated milk
20–25g bird’s eye chillies (chilli padi), leave whole and lightly smashed
4 stalks curry leaves, use leaves only
Seasoning

1/2 tsp salt
1/2 tsp sugar
Thickening

1 tbsp corn flour mixed with 1½ tbsp water

Method


Clean crabs and poach them, then drain well. Remove the pincers and crack with a pestle. Trim the legs and cut each crab into four pieces. Set aside. Heat margarine in a wok until melted then add the milk. Gently simmer the mixture over a medium heat. Add the curry leaves, chilli padi and seasoning. Simmer for 10–15 minutes. Add thickening and stir gently over a very low heat until sauce is thick and glossy in texture. Return crabs to the mixture and cook over a very low heat for about 1 minute. Dish out the crabs with the curry leaves, chilli padi and a little of the sauce. Serve immediately.
